Welcome to the Jefferson County Auditor's web site. The Auditor's Office performs numerous functions to ensure your tax dollars are being spent prudently and for the purposes for which they are intended. Jefferson County operates on a budget of more than $92 million dollars and conducts many thousands of transactions each year.
The Auditor's Office employs a full-time staff of three employees who are responsible for overseeing all transactions and maintaining the General Ledger. The Office conducts an annual physical inventory of County assets and maintains the fixed assets ledger.
The monies received by various County departments are monitored by the Auditor's Office and departmental reports are reviewed each month.
Additionally, the Auditor's Office works with more than forty offices and departments to ensure all transactions are in compliance with the approved budget and that all revenue projections are progressing as anticipated. It is the mission of the Auditor's Office to ensure that your hard-earned tax dollars are not wasted, but are used to make Jefferson County one of the best places to live and work in Missouri. We work diligently toward that goal.
